Verdin IMX8MM and Riverdi MIPI DSI Touch Display

Hello,

we are currently looking for a display for our Verdin IMX8M Mini, I have my eye on the Riverdi RVT70HSMNWC00-B, it has a MIPI DSI interface. I am not a display interface expert but from the datasheets it looks to me like it will work.

Does anyone know of it works together ?

Dear @DrWenz,

Most displays that have compatible interfaces with our modules are able to work without much problems. You may need however to edit the device tree by adding custom overlays for them to behave properly (setting resolution, timings…). I suggest you look into this page: Device Tree Overlays (Linux) | Toradex Developer Center that describes the topic and has even some information about the device trees that we have pre-built.

To add the device trees to your image by default you could refer to: Custom meta layers, recipes and images in Yocto Project (hello-world examples) | Toradex Developer Center (for our Reference BSP’s) or TorizonCore Builder Tool “build” command | Toradex Developer Center (for TorizonCore).

Looking at the datasheet of your display, it seems however that when you build your carrier board, you’ll probably need to design your own connection interfaces as, for instance, the X48 connector on the Verdin Development Board has 60 pins connected and the cables on your display would have 50.
